It carries a 3 x 3P (3 NO) contact configuration and is rated for AC-3 utilisation category, meaning it is built to switch three-phase induction motors under starting and running conditions. The 80 A rating is the AC-3 motor current, not a resistive load figure — that is the number to match against your motor's full-load amps. Operating temperature range is -40 to 140 °F (-40 to 60 °C), with derating above 140 °F up to 158 °F (70 °C). Storage range is -76 to 176 °F (-60 to 80 °C). The unit is treated for tropical environments (TH per IEC 60068-2-30) and rated for operation up to 3000 m altitude. Flame retardance is V1 conforming to UL 94, with fire resistance at 1562 °F (850 °C) per IEC 60695-2-1.","metaTitle":"LC3D80E7 TeSys D Star Delta Starter, 80 A, 48 V AC Coil","metaDescription":"Obsolete TeSys D star delta starter, 3 x 3P (3 NO), 80 A AC-3, 48 V AC coil.
